Homeowner rages over HOA fine for parking in his own driveway and gets revenge

A HOMEOWNER was slapped with an HOA fine for parking in his own driveway.

Chase’s unique motor disgruntled his HOA (Homeowners Association) and he was given a penalty that claimed it was “inoperable”.

The machine is the front end of an old Mercedes built on a Toyota Tacoma frame and boasts lowrider suspension.

Despite being tagged, it didn’t have license plates, and Chase believed that his neighbours reported it to the HOA.

On his Prodigy TV YouTube channel he said: “Everyone here has seen it operate before,

“So, I’m not sure why the HOA is saying it’s inoperable.”

The car was originally hidden away in the woods, but one of Chase’s friends told him to proudly park it on the drive.

“I knew he’d get a letter from the HOA,” one of his friends laughed in the video.

Taking revenge against the HOA and his neighbours who reported the car, Graham drove his lowrider up and down the street.

“I don’t know what the neighbours don’t like about this car,” Chase’s pal laughed.

“I love it!” Chase agreed.

His friends captured the footage and posted it on the HOA’s official Facebook page.

If that wasn’t enough, he bought a customised license plate which read: “F U HOA”.

He added: “This is just to show the HOA how much we love and appreciate them, as well as their strict rules.”

Chase also revealed how he received an HOA letter for another of his motors after one of the wheels was parked slightly on his grass.

“A couple of months ago I get a letter in the mail, not only for this car (the Mercedes lowrider) but I have another car parked in the driveway.

Gesturing roughly three inches, he explained: “The tire was this far in the grass. They sent me a letter saying I can’t park on the grass. So Graham was like ‘we are going to troll the absolute dogs*** out of them.”

“This isn’t the only issue though. The man gets fined for parking his truck and trailer in the road, he gets parked if we leave a car in the road for more than two hours” his Graham explained.

Chase joked: “If I fart and it smells bad, HOA fine immediately. So Graham was like ‘we’re gonna do the icing on the cake’, and I’m moving out in a couple of months ”
